Evaluating the Inner Pot: Will the Non-Stick Coating Hold Up?
One of the most common complaints about budget-friendly rice cookers is the inner pot. You buy a new appliance, and within a few months, the non-stick coating starts to bubble, peel, or scratch, rendering it difficult to use and clean. This forces you into a frustrating cycle of frequent replacements. The Astron rice cooker directly addresses this primary pain point with an inner pot engineered for durability.
The pot is constructed from aluminum with a reinforced non-stick coating. This design choice is critical for two reasons:
- Heat Conductivity: Aluminum ensures that heat from the base element spreads quickly and evenly across the bottom and up the sides of the pot, which is essential for uniform cooking.
- Coating Resilience: The reinforced coating is specifically formulated to resist the daily wear and tear of scooping and cleaning. It is less prone to the premature degradation that plagues many lower-quality alternatives, especially in a humid environment where moisture can accelerate wear.
To maximize the lifespan of the inner pot and ensure your investment lasts, follow these simple but effective practices:
- Use the Right Utensils: Always use the plastic or silicone spatula that comes with the rice cooker. Avoid using metal spoons or forks to scoop rice, as they will inevitably scratch and compromise the non-stick surface.
- Gentle Washing Techniques: After cooking, allow the pot to cool down before washing. Submerging a hot pot in cold water can cause warping and damage the coating over time. Use a soft sponge and mild dish soap. Avoid abrasive scrubbers or steel wool at all costs.
- Soak, Don't Scrape: If any rice sticks to the bottom, simply fill the pot with warm, soapy water and let it soak for 15-20 minutes. The residue will lift off easily without any need for harsh scraping.
By following these guidelines, you ensure the integrity of the coating for years, not months. This long-term durability means fewer replacements, more predictable meal prep, and steadier financial planning.
Heat Distribution and Power Consumption: Avoiding Burnt Rice and Hidden Costs
Two major anxieties when using any daily cooking appliance are inconsistent results and hidden utility costs. There is nothing more frustrating than a rice cooker that produces a perfectly fluffy top layer but leaves a burnt, crusty bottom. Likewise, an inefficient appliance can slowly inflate your monthly electricity bill without you noticing. The Astron rice cooker is designed to tackle both of these issues with a simple, effective system.
The core of its performance lies in the synergy between its base heating plate and a mechanical thermostat. The heating plate is engineered to distribute heat uniformly across the entire base of the inner pot. This prevents “hot spots” that cause scorching in specific areas. The magic happens when the water is fully absorbed. A magnetic thermostat at the base of the unit detects the sharp rise in temperature that occurs once all the liquid has evaporated. This change triggers the switch, automatically dropping the power output and transitioning the unit from “Cook” to “Keep Warm” mode. This process is purely mechanical, making it incredibly reliable and ensuring your rice is never overcooked.

Building a Low-Stress Daily Meal Prep Routine
A dependable rice cooker is more than just a tool for cooking rice; it’s the cornerstone of a low-stress meal prep system that saves you time, money, and mental energy throughout the week. By integrating your Astron rice cooker into a weekly plan, you can remove the daily guesswork from meal times and support your household budget. Here’s how to build an efficient routine around it.
1. Master Batch Cooking: Dedicate one or two days a week to cook larger batches of rice. A 1.8-liter model, for example, can cook up to 10 cups of rice, which is often enough for several days of meals for a small family. This simple act of cooking in bulk means you have a ready-to-go base for fried rice, grain bowls, or a simple side dish on busy weeknights.
2. Practice Safe Cooling and Storage: In warm climates, proper food storage is non-negotiable to prevent spoilage. Once the rice is cooked, do not leave it in the “Keep Warm” mode for more than a few hours. For batch cooking, fluff the rice and spread it on a baking sheet to cool down quickly. Once it reaches room temperature, transfer it to airtight containers and refrigerate immediately. This method prevents bacteria growth and preserves the texture of the rice for up to 3-4 days.
3. Perform Basic Maintenance for Efficiency: A clean appliance is an efficient appliance. To preserve the heating efficiency and longevity of your rice cooker, make a habit of performing these simple tasks:
- Wipe the Heating Plate: After every use, once the unit is unplugged and cool, wipe the inner heating plate with a damp cloth to remove any spilled water or rice grains. Debris on the plate can cause uneven heating and may lead to scorching.
- Check the Moisture Collector: Many models have a small detachable cup that collects condensation. Empty and clean this regularly to prevent overflow and keep your counter clean.
- Store Properly: Keep the rice cooker in a dry place, and ensure the inner pot is completely dry before placing it back inside the unit for storage.
By embracing these practices, your rice cooker becomes a predictable and powerful ally. It supports steady household budgeting by enabling cost-effective batch meals and removes the daily pressure of deciding what to cook, giving you more time and energy for other things.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
- Q: How long can the auto keep-warm function safely run without drying out the rice?
A: The optimal window for the keep-warm function is typically 4–6 hours. Beyond this, the rice texture may start to degrade and dry out. In a humid environment, moisture loss is naturally slower, but for best results, transfer any leftovers to an airtight container for refrigeration if you don't plan to eat them within that period. - Q: Is this rice cooker suitable for college dorms with shared or limited electrical outlets?
A: Yes, it is generally suitable. Its standard 400W–600W power draw is well within the limits of most dorm electrical circuits and is unlikely to cause a trip. For safety, it is highly recommended to plug the rice cooker directly into a wall socket rather than using a multi-plug extension cord, which can overheat. - Q: How does the heating mechanism prevent burnt edges on the bottom layer?
A: The unit uses a magnetic thermostat that precisely monitors the internal temperature. The base plate is designed to spread heat evenly, and once all the water has been absorbed by the rice, the temperature inside the pot rises sharply. This change causes the thermostat to automatically switch off the main heating element and transition to the low-power keep-warm mode, stopping the cooking cycle before scorching can occur. - Q: What should you verify about service centers before purchasing for long-term use?
